Hi everyone. I purchased a window cleaning round at the start of last year & everything was going ok until yesterday when 2 people informed me that the previous cleaner had shown up a few weeks earlier & said he had taken over the round again as I'd stopped doing it (which is untrue).  I know I can put this joker in his place in terms of quality of cleaning as he was a cowboy to put it mildly but has anyone else had a similar crazy issue & how did they deal with it?  Thanks for your time. Sean.

You need to call with your customers and explain the situation.
Have a letter handy for any that are not at home but I would make the effort to speak to them all
personally.
I guarantee when they hear what a shifty character he is they wont want him near their properties.
Legally there's nothing you can do unless you have signed a contract stating that he wont clean in that
area again.
